Tomah, Wisconsin, sits at the junction of Interstates 90 and 94, a location locals proudly call the "Gateway to Wisconsin's Coulee Country." That central position makes Tomah genuinely convenient for renters who want small-city living without feeling cut off from the rest of the Midwest. Madison and La Crosse are both within easy driving distance, and the interstate access means weekend trips or work commutes to larger cities are straightforward. The city itself has a lot going on for its size. Downtown Tomah has real character, with historic commercial buildings along Superior Avenue and a restored railroad depot that reflects the city's roots as a 19th-century transportation hub. Local parks like Gillett Park and Superior Park give residents solid options for getting outside, whether that's a walk, a pickup game, or a picnic.
